    This killed me when I was there. I was consistently in the top 5 drivers of the north salt lake OC, and it took me a year to get .40 (dryvan, with 13 years exp) but some 1 yr rookie in another area gets a 10k bonus and .41 cpm out of the gate. Our recruiter flat out called me a liar, so I showed her the ad that SNI had for several other OCs , and Utah was the lowest paid. I stayed out for 3 months at a time and hardly ever went nack to that OC, but got paid less than a rookies starting wage somewhere else.

    Still irritates me
